Re: [RC] Horse won't pulse down/ DINKs - Kristen A FisherDoes misbehaving really mean a horse is ready to do a 50 when it's only done one 25? [Even a slow 50?] I have heard this suggested to her a couple times. Seems that maybe more experience in that environment would more directly address the issue, rather than more miles, especially if you do not know whether the horse's cardiovascular and soft tissue systems make it ready for a 50.
